This dish is simple and delicious! The key is the preparation of the sauce, which is much easier to make than it sounds. Even I, the most clumsy kitchen-person I know, can make it!
The sauce is made of soysauce and egg. You want to mix one egg (both yolk and whites) together with soysauce. (portions: 1 egg, 1 cup of soysauce). Put oil in frying pan (2 tablespoons), heat up frying pan and pour mixture in. Keep the stove on medium heat. Keep stirring the mixture until it thickens. Once the mixture turns into a sauce/paste texture, pour it out into a bowl. (the entire process in the frying pan shouldn't take more than 5 minutes)
Wash the cucumber thoroughly! The best type of cucumber for this dish is the Japanese cucumbers, they're fairly expensive, about $1.49 to $1.99 each. (Available in almost all American supermarkets!)
